$10,000 damages in Lima house fire

First Posted: 1/22/2015

LIMA — A vacant house at 820 E. Michael Ave. sustained $10,000 in damages from an early morning house fire Thursday, the Lima Fire Department reported.

Crews were called just after midnight and were on the scene until about 1:30 a.m. When they arrived smoke was visible from the attic of the single-story house.

The LFD said the house had caught fire once before a few months ago, however the details of that fire were not available Thursday morning. The electricity had been turned off in the house and there was minimal furnishings inside.

Reportedly, the house was undergoing repair work. The LFD said it is unclear if the work conducted on the house caused the fire.

The house is owned by Shawn Wakefield and valued at $23,800, according to the Allen County Auditor’s website. The LFD said the house sustained $10,000 of damage.
